Vanderbilt has fired head coach Bryce Drew after just three seasons.

Here’s an excerpt from Jeff Goodman’s article:

In a shocking move, Vanderbilt is terminating Bryce Drew as head coach after just three seasons, sources told @Stadium.

Drew, 44, went to the NCAA tournament in his first year and played all but five games this season without the Commodores starting point guard and likely lottery pick Darius Garland – who suffered a season-ending knee injury on Nov. 23.

This is a baffling decision by new athletic director Malcolm Turner, who took over less than two months ago.
